Faire une somme.si.ens sur excel 2003

Résolu/Fermé
eloddy - 9 avril 2010 à 23:11
 eloddy - 11 avril 2010 à 14:19
Bonjour,

J'ai lu les messages précédents mais n'arrive pas à les transposer à mon cas. Je veux faire un somme.si avec plusieurs critères, sur Excel 2003.

Les conditions sont avec du texte. Par exemple.

A B C D
Age Nombre Nationnalité Client
adulte 1 française oui
enfant 2 française oui
senior 1 marocain oui
adolescent 4 italien non
adulte 10 française oui
adulte 5 américain non
enfant 2 japonais non
adulte 2 japonais oui

Je veux par exemple calculer le nb d'adultes français client de mon entreprise.
Sur Excel 2007, j'aurais fait la formule suivante :
=SOMME.SI.ENS(B:B;A:A;"adulte";C:C;"française";D:D;"oui")

Mais sur Excel 2003 je n'arrive pas à trouver d'équivalent
Merci d'avance pour vos conseils....!

A voir également:

3 réponses

Bonjour

et avec
=SOMMEPROD((($A$2:$A$9="adulte")*($C$2:$C$9="française")*($D$2:$D$9="oui")))

avec sommeprod, tu ne peux pas faire sur une colonne entière
Argitxu
0
Merci
J'ai essayé également cette formule mais sommeprod n'est pas pris en compte dans excel 2003 je crois.

Là je suis en train d'essayer de concatener les colonnes entre elles et de faire ensuite un somme.si, je pense que ça peut marcher, mais c'est un peu long !
0
Raymond PENTIER Messages postés 58389 Date d'inscription lundi 13 août 2007 Statut Contributeur Dernière intervention 18 avril 2024 17 090
11 avril 2010 à 03:03
"mais sommeprod n'est pas pris en compte dans excel 2003 je crois."
FAUX !
As-tu essayé ? Si oui, as-tu bien respecté la syntaxe ? Regarde bien les formules de tontong et argixu ...
0
tontong Messages postés 2548 Date d'inscription mercredi 3 février 2010 Statut Membre Dernière intervention 15 mars 2024 1 054
10 avril 2010 à 11:40
Bonjour,
Quand vous aurez goûté à Sommeprod vous ne pourrez plus vous en passer ;-)
Cette formule existait déjà bien avant Excel 2003, elle était seulement un peu limitée a ses débuts par les performances des processeurs.
Mon intervention consistera seulement à compléter la formule d'Argixu qui a perdu la colonne B en chemin.
SOMMEPROD((($A$2:$A$200="adulte")*($C$2:$C$200="française")*($D$2:$D$200="oui")*($B$2:$B$200)))
Les champs peuvent être étendus, une seule contrainte: ils doivent tous avoir la même dimension.
0
Utilisateur anonyme
10 avril 2010 à 13:09
Bonjour,
Un copié-collé oublié. Merci Tontong :-))
0
Super ça marche ! Merci bien pour vos réponses, je suis déjà devenue accro à sommeprod !
0